Gelbart Receives Service-Learning Endowed Scholarship

Published Thursday, August 10th, 2017

Andrew Gelbart is WSC's 2017-18 Service-Learning Endowed Scholarship recipient, with an award of $500.

Andrew GelbartWayne State College announces Andrew Gelbart is the 2017-18 Service-Learning Endowed Scholarship recipient.  His award is $500.

Gelbart is a senior majoring in graphic design with a minor in speech communication. He also maintains a high GPA.  He is the son of Ralph and Julia Gelbart of Omaha. 

“Service-Learning is more than helping my community,’’ Gelbart said. “It has helped me build a stronger and defining character.” 

“Andrew Gelbart has participated in six Service-Learning projects in art and communication courses,”  said Lisa Nelson, Director of Service-Learning at WSC. “He collaborated on Service-Learning projects including historical photo restorations, a media campaign for Micah’s Closet and images of constellations for the Fred G. Dale Planetarium.”

Joshua Piersanti of the Wayne State College Art Department advises Gelbart.

“Andrew Gelbart’s work on projects is always clear, carefully considered and aligned within the project goals,’’ Piersanti said. “We typically invite community partners to speak with our students before beginning projects so that the students understand what they need.” 

The Service-Learning Program at Wayne State College awards this scholarship each year. All enrolled students who have participated in two or more academic Service-Learning projects or events and have completed 30 credit hours are eligible to apply.
